I'm not really sure I understand what you mean.  by "granularity", I just
meant that you can't really have fractional sysadmins, and a rack with 1 node
consumes as much floor space as a full rack.  in some sense, smaller clusters
have their costs "rounded down" - there's a size beneath which you tend to
avoid paying for power, cooling, etc.  perhaps that's what you meant by cost-
accounting.

but do you think these were really important at the beginning?  to me,
beowulf is "attack of the killer micro" applied to parallelism.  that is,
mass-market computers that killed the traditional glass-house boxes:
vector supers, minis, eventually anything non-x86.  the difference was 
fundamental (much cheaper cycles), rather than these secondary issues.

well, HPC is unique in scale of bursting.  even if you go on a book binge,
there's no way you can consume orders of magnitude  more books as I can,
or compared to your trailing-year average.  but that's the big win for HPC 
centers - if everyone had a constant demand, a center would deliver only 
small advantages, not even much better than a colo site.
